Factors Influencing the Cost of a Crypto Exchange License in Vietnam
The cost structure surrounding a crypto exchange license in Vietnam can be complex. Here are some crucial factors:

ong>Legal and Compliance Fees: ong> Engaging with local legal experts typically costs betweenong>$5,000 ong> toong>$15,000 ong>, depending on the requirements.ong>Operational Costs: ong> Setting up technology infrastructure can range fromong>$10,000 ong> to overong>$50,000 ong>, based on the exchange’s scale.ong>Licensing Fees: ong> The government may impose varying fees depending on the type of exchange license applied for and its compliance standards.ong>Marketing and Launch Costs: ong> Initial promotions in a competitive environment can add anotherong>$15,000 ong> toong>$100,000 ong>.
Prospective Costs Breakdown
Let’s analyze a hypothetical cost breakdown for opening a crypto exchange in Vietnam:
| Cost Item | Estimated Cost (USD) |
|---|---|
| Legal and Compliance | $5,000 – $15,000 |
| Technology Infrastructure | $10,000 – $50,000 |
| Licensing Fees | $3,000 – $10,000 |
| Marketing and Launch | $15,000 – $100,000 |
